Guinness Beef Ribs
- 4 lbs short rib of beef
- Marinade
- 24 fluid ounces Guinness stout
- 1 large onion, sliced
- 4 fluid ounces low sodium soy sauce
- 1/2 cup brown sugar, firmly packed
- 2 fluid ounces sesame oil
- 3 tablespoons minced garlic
- Glaze
- 8 fluid ounces honey
- 2 fluid ounces low sodium soy sauce
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
- 1 tablespoon minced garlic
- 1 1/2 teaspoons ground pepper
- ---To Prepare The Ribs---.
- In a large bowl, whisk together the Guinness, onion, 4 fluid ounces soy sauce, brown sugar, sesame oil, and 3 tablespoons minced garlic.
- Place the ribs in a glass baking dish and pour the marinade over them.
- Cover and refrigerate overnight.
- ---To Prepare The Glaze---.
- In a medium bowl, whisk together the honey, 2 fluid ounces soy sauce, parsley, 1 tablespoon garlic, and pepper.
- ---Fire Up The Grill---.
- Remove the ribs from the marinade and place them on the grill over medium coals.
- Grill until cooked through, turning occasionally, about 10-15 minutes.
- Brush with the glaze and cook 1 minute per side.
- Serve with the remaining glaze.
